Dominant groups
Analysis of the male five year age groups of Woodvale in 2021 compared to City of Joondalup shows that there was a lower proportion of males in the younger age groups (under 15) and a similar proportion of males in the older age groups (65+).
Overall, 18.5% of the male population was aged between 0 and 15, and 17.3% were aged 65 years and over, compared with 19.4% and 17.2% respectively for City of Joondalup.
The major differences between the male age structure of Woodvale and City of Joondalup were:
- A larger percentage of males aged 55 to 59 (8.6% compared to 6.7%)
- A larger percentage of males aged 60 to 64 (8.1% compared to 6.4%)
- A smaller percentage of males aged 30 to 34 (3.6% compared to 5.4%)
- A smaller percentage of males aged 0 to 4 (4.1% compared to 5.5%)
Emerging groups
From 2006 to 2021, Woodvale's male population decreased by 402 people (8.4%). This represents an average annual population change of -0.59% per year over the period.
The largest changes in male age structure in this area between 2006 and 2021 were in the age groups:
- 15 to 19 (-242 males)
- 45 to 49 (-215 males)
- 65 to 69 (+192 males)
- 60 to 64 (+188 males)
